Merchant Cash Advance Loans: Fast Funding Options for New Ventures
New ventures often face a challenge in securing traditional funding. This can make it difficult to launch and grow a business quickly. Luckily, merchant cash advance loans offer click here an solution for entrepreneurs seeking immediate capital. These loans are based on your anticipated sales, providing|a flexible funding option tailored to the needs of startups and young businesses.
With a merchant cash advance, you receive a lump sum funds upfront, which you then settle over time through daily|of your sales. This structure can be particularly helpful for businesses with predictable cash flow.

li Merchant cash advances often have a quicker application process compared to traditional loans.
li They don't require a credit check, making them accessible to businesses with less established profiles.
li The funds can be used for a wide range of business expenses, such as inventory, marketing, or equipment upgrades.

While merchant cash advances can be a valuable tool for new ventures, it's crucial to carefully consider the terms and conditions before entering into an agreement.

Obtaining Business Financing Options
Navigating the realm of business financing can appear daunting, particularly for entrepreneurs just initiating their ventures. However, a range of funding options are present, each tailored to satisfy the unique needs of different businesses. From traditional loans to more innovative approaches like crowdfunding and venture capital, understanding the spectrum of choices is crucial for securing the capital necessary for growth and success.
- Classic Loans: These offer a organized approach to financing, requiring regular contributions.
- Credit Facilities: Flexible funding options that allow businesses to access funds as needed, up to a predetermined limit.
- Small Business Administration (SBA) Loans: Government-backed loans aimed to support the growth and development of small businesses.
When exploring business financing options, it's imperative to thoroughly assess your monetary circumstances, project your upcoming needs, and evaluate the conditions offered by different lenders.
